WebAll data types are allowed except text, ntext, and image. Starting with SQL Server 2012 (11.x) and Azure SQL Database, if any one of the specified non-key columns are varchar … WebNov 10, 2016 · The index is used to support the ETL process. The varbinary is used to check for the existence of a record rather than joining on the nvarchar field. – Adrian S …
Binary Indexed Tree / Fenwick Tree :: AlgoTree
WebMay 11, 2024 · Binary Indexed Tree is a data structure that is used to efficiently calculate the prefix sum of a series (array) of numbers. It is also known as the Fenwick tree as … WebA Fenwick Tree (a.k.a. Binary Indexed Tree, or BIT) is a fairly common data structure. BITs are used to efficiently answer certain types of range queries, on ranges from a root to some distant node. ... (We exclude zero as its binary representation doesn't have any ones.) For example, interval ending at 7 (111) has a length of one, 4 (100) has ... sims 4 movie hangout stuff
Range update + range query with binary indexed trees
WebJul 1, 2024 · Make a new array BIT of length N + 1. Now, traverse the array from left to right and add the current element to the BIT. When ith element (A [i]) is inserted in the BIT, check for the length of the longest subsequence that can be formed till A [i] – 1. Let this value be x. If x + 1 is greater than the current element in BIT, update the BIT. WebJul 29, 2016 · Original Problem: HackerRank. I am trying to count the number of inversions using Binary Indexed Tree in an array. I've tried to optimise my code as much as I can. WebNov 28, 2024 · The problem can be solved efficiently by using the prefix sum. Create two prefix sum arrays to store the sum of odd indexed elements and even indexed elements from the beginning to a certain index. Use them to get the sum of odd indexed and even indexed elements for each subarray. Follow the steps mentioned below to implement … rcc construction rate